JEE Main 2025 April 3 Student Reaction and Analysis (Shift 2 OUT)
As soon as the JEE Main 2025 shift 2 exams end, the exam analysis based on student reaction and experts' opinions is being provided in the table below:
JEE Main 2025 April 2 Exam | Shift 2 Analysis |
Overall paper difficulty | Moderate to Tough |
Subject-wise difficulty level |
Maths - Moderate Physics - Moderate Chemistry - Moderate to tough |
Topics with high weightage in Maths | Conic Section, Hyperbola, Straight Lines, Circle, Integration, Permutation and Combination, Vector and 3D, Matrices and Determinants, Quadratic |
Topics with high weightage in Physics | Current Electricity, Capacitor, Wave Optics, Units and Dimensions, Thermodynamics, Ray Optics, Magnetic Effect, Semiconductors |
Topics with high weightage in Chemistry | Titration, Salt analysis, Biomolecules |
Weightage of class 11 and 12 syllabus | Equal weightage to class 11 and 12 syllabus |

JEE Main 3 April 2025 Shift 2 Physics Question Paper with Answer Key
Q.No. | Question | Answers |
1 | The ratio of intensities of two coherent is 1:9. The ratio of the maximum to the minimum intensities is | 4:1 |
2 | Excess pressure inside bubble A is half of that of bubble B. Find ratio of volume of bubble A to bubble B. | 8 |
3 | In a resonance tube experiment at one end, resonance is obtained at two consecutive lengths / 1 = 100 cm and / 2 = 140 cm. If the frequency of the sound is 400 Hz, the velocity of sound is | 320 m/s |
